What Is a Mesothelioma Compensation?
A settlement is a monetary sum that both sides in a legal dispute have agreed to. Trials have a significant degree of risk, so reaching a settlement is a sure method to get your money. Victims of asbestos exposure who acquire the rare malignancy mesothelioma receive compensation in the form of settlements. Asbestos manufacturing businesses are to blame for this sickness. Inhaled or swallowed asbestos can cause cell irritation in certain parts of the body.

Asbestos manufacturers were aware of the risks of the chemical, but they continued to create and sell it. Almost the entire 20th century was devoted to the distribution of asbestos to the building and insulation industries. Many people have been exposed to asbestos as a result of their actions and those of other corporations.

Insurance Coverage for Mesothelioma Victims
Compensation for mesothelioma victims ranges from $800,000 to $2.4 million on average. Asbestos trust funds, settlements, or jury judgments can all provide compensation for mesothelioma victims. Trust funds and settlements often pay out mesothelioma compensation in less than a year. Trial verdicts might take a long time to be processed and compensated for.

Mesothelioma patients should keep track of their medical costs.

As a starting point, consider how your disease has affected your daily routine and your budget in order to cover the costs of medical care as well as the costs of additional therapies. You may have to pay for transportation to and from medical providers in addition to the cost of treatment and health insurance. Hire a home health aide to help with anything from cooking and cleaning to yard work and basic upkeep. Keep an eye out for alternative treatments like massage therapy that may be able to reduce some of your problems as well. Your health insurance may or may not pay for these expenses.
